Multidisciplinary Studies Overview

Degree Overview

The objectives of the Multidisciplinary Studies major are to:

  • broaden the student's understanding, interests, and skills;
  • help the student become a more responsible, productive member of the family and community; and
  • offer a degree program with sufficient electives to permit some specialization according to the student's interests or career plans.

Multidisciplinary Studies is a complete two-year degree major. However, graduates who later seek admission to baccalaureate degree majors may apply baccalaureate credits toward the new degree.

In addition to baccalaureate majors offered at Penn State Berks, and a wide variety of baccalaureate majors offered at University Park campus, graduates of the Multidisciplinary Studies major may qualify for admission to the baccalaureate degree majors in Behavioral Sciences, Elementary Education, Humanities, or Public Policy offered at Penn State Harrisburg. In addition, they may qualify for any of a large number of baccalaureate degree majors offered by Penn State Erie, The Behrend College, in business, the liberal arts, and sciences.
